feeling bad for totally neglecting this thread. :)
I have finished some 40 books since my last update here. With that also achieved my GR goal of 110 books.
highlight of last 4 months :-
wrapped up Kate Daniels series. Series has 10 books and I reread 4-9 to prepare myself for the finale. I had a gala time even with the rereads. A must read if you like a witty heroine and UF.
Tawny Man - this I pick up on a whim as few others were reading it in some other group and i just joined the BR. I wasn't expecting much after the Farseer trilogy but oh boy, this blew me away. I am so glad that i read this.
WoT 1-6 - slowly plodding through this huge series with Iniya. things were going great till book 4 but now plot has slowed down, which in turn has slowed our speed too. but she and I are adamant on finishing it this year so hopefully we'll pick up speed even if the plot in books doesn't pick up.
